
Kunci publik dan privat sangat penting untuk enkripsi, yang menjaga data tetap aman di internet. Alat-alat kriptografi ini memungkinkan segala sesuatu mulai dari belanja online yang aman hingga email yang aman, tetapi peran dan perbedaannya bisa membingungkan.
Artikel ini menjelaskan konsep kunci publik dan privat secara sederhana, dengan menyoroti penggunaan, kekuatan, dan aplikasi praktisnya. Pada akhirnya, Anda akan memiliki pemahaman yang jelas tentang bagaimana mereka melindungi data sensitif dan mengapa mereka sangat penting untuk keamanan digital.
Daftar Isi
- Dasar-dasar Kriptografi
- Apa yang dimaksud dengan Kunci Publik?
- Apa yang dimaksud dengan Kunci Pribadi?
- Kunci Publik vs Kunci Pribadi: Perbedaan Utama
- Kekuatan dan Kelemahan Kunci Publik dan Kunci Privat
Dasar-dasar Kriptografi
Kriptografi adalah praktik mengamankan informasi melalui enkripsi, mengubah data menjadi kode yang tidak dapat dibaca untuk melindunginya dari akses yang tidak sah. Ini adalah fondasi keamanan digital, memastikan kerahasiaan, integritas, dan otentikasi selama transmisi data.
Ada dua metode utama enkripsi: simetris dan asimetris.
Enkripsi simetris menggunakan satu kunci untuk enkripsi dan dekripsi, membuatnya cepat dan efisien, tetapi rentan terhadap risiko keamanan selama berbagi kunci.
Sebaliknya, enkripsi asimetris melibatkan sepasang kunci: kunci publik untuk enkripsi dan kunci privat untuk dekripsi. Pendekatan ini menghilangkan kebutuhan untuk berbagi kunci rahasia, sehingga meningkatkan keamanan.
Kedua metode ini sangat penting dalam sistem digital saat ini. Enkripsi simetris unggul dalam mengenkripsi data dalam jumlah besar dengan cepat. Sebaliknya, enkripsi asimetris ideal untuk komunikasi dan autentikasi yang aman, yang sering kali didukung oleh infrastruktur kunci publik (PKI) untuk mengelola dan mendistribusikan kunci secara efektif.
Apa yang dimaksud dengan Kunci Publik?
Kunci publik adalah kode kriptografi yang digunakan dalam sistem enkripsi asimetris. Ini adalah bagian dari pasangan kunci publik-pribadi, di mana kunci publik dibagikan secara terbuka dan digunakan untuk mengenkripsi data atau memverifikasi tanda tangan digital. Tidak seperti kunci pribadi, yang tetap rahasia, kunci publik dapat didistribusikan secara luas tanpa mengorbankan keamanan.
Hubungan matematis antara kunci publik dan privat memastikan bahwa hanya kunci privat yang sesuai yang dapat mendekripsi data yang dienkripsi dengan kunci publik. Fungsi satu arah ini membuat kunci publik sangat penting untuk komunikasi yang aman, karena memungkinkan siapa saja untuk mengirim data terenkripsi sambil memastikan bahwa hanya penerima yang dituju, yang memegang kunci privat, yang dapat mendekripsinya.
Kunci publik digunakan secara luas dalam aplikasi dunia nyata, seperti teknologi blockchain, tanda tangan digital, dan Sertifikat SSL/TLS. Sebagai contoh, sertifikat SSL situs web berisi kunci publik yang memungkinkan koneksi yang aman antara peramban dan server, melindungi data sensitif seperti kredensial login.
Apa yang dimaksud dengan Kunci Pribadi?
Kunci pribadi adalah komponen penting dari enkripsi asimetris, yang dirancang untuk mendekripsi data yang dienkripsi dengan kunci publik yang sesuai. Tidak seperti kunci publik, kunci privat tetap rahasia dan hanya diketahui oleh pemiliknya, memastikan keamanan informasi sensitif.
Kunci pribadi digunakan untuk lebih dari sekadar dekripsi-kunci pribadi juga memungkinkan tanda tangan digital yang aman. Sebagai contoh, ketika menandatangani sebuah dokumen, private key menghasilkan tanda tangan digital yang unik, yang dapat diverifikasi dengan menggunakan public key yang sesuai untuk mengonfirmasi keaslian penandatangan.
Kerahasiaan kunci pribadi adalah yang terpenting. Jika dikompromikan, akses yang tidak sah ke data terenkripsi atau aset digital menjadi mungkin. Untuk alasan ini, private key sering kali disimpan dengan aman menggunakan dompet perangkat keras, drive terenkripsi, atau solusi penyimpanan offline. Dalam aplikasi seperti komunikasi email yang aman atau transaksi mata uang digital, private key menjamin privasi dan integritas data atau aset yang dilindungi.
Kunci Publik vs Kunci Pribadi: Perbedaan Utama
Kunci publik dan privat adalah dua sisi dari koin kriptografi yang sama, masing-masing memiliki tujuan yang berbeda tetapi saling melengkapi. Walaupun keduanya merupakan bagian integral dari enkripsi asimetris, keduanya berbeda secara signifikan dalam hal fungsi, penggunaan, dan implikasi keamanan.
Kunci publik dirancang untuk enkripsi dan dibagikan secara terbuka kepada siapa saja yang perlu mengirim data yang aman. Kunci ini juga dapat memverifikasi tanda tangan digital, memastikan bahwa pesan atau dokumen berasal dari pengirim yang sah. Di sisi lain, kunci privat dijaga kerahasiaannya dan digunakan untuk dekripsi atau menandatangani pesan secara digital. Dualitas ini memastikan bahwa meskipun kunci publik didistribusikan secara luas, data tetap aman, karena hanya kunci privat yang dapat mendekripsinya.
Berikut ini adalah perbandingan yang mendetail:
Aspek | Kunci Publik | Kunci Pribadi |
Tujuan | Enkripsi data, verifikasi tanda tangan | Mendekripsi data, membuat tanda tangan |
Aksesibilitas | Dibagikan secara publik | Dirahasiakan |
Jenis Kunci | Asimetris | Asimetris |
Peran Keamanan | Memastikan kerahasiaan | Menjaga kerahasiaan |
Kasus Penggunaan | Sertifikat SSL/TLS, blockchain | Transaksi yang aman, otentikasi |
Kunci publik sangat ideal untuk berbagi data dengan aman tanpa komunikasi sebelumnya, seperti pada enkripsi email atau protokol SSL/TLS. Akan tetapi, kunci privat membutuhkan penyimpanan yang aman dan kerahasiaan yang ketat untuk mencegah pembobolan.
Interaksi antara kunci publik dan pribadi mendukung keamanan sistem digital. Sebagai contoh, ketika mengirim email yang aman, pengirim mengenkripsi pesan menggunakan kunci publik penerima. Hanya kunci privat penerima yang dapat mendekripsi pesan tersebut, memastikan kerahasiaan dan keasliannya. Bersama-sama, kunci-kunci ini memungkinkan sistem enkripsi yang kuat yang mampu melindungi informasi sensitif di dunia yang semakin saling terhubung.
Kekuatan dan Kelemahan Kunci Publik dan Kunci Privat
Kunci publik dan privat menawarkan kekuatan dan kelemahan yang unik, membuatnya cocok untuk berbagai aplikasi dalam kriptografi.
Kekuatan Kunci Publik
- Distribusi Kunci yang aman: Karena kunci publik dapat dibagikan secara terbuka, maka hal ini menghilangkan kebutuhan akan pertukaran kunci yang aman, sebuah keuntungan yang signifikan dibandingkan dengan enkripsi simetris.
- Skalabilitas: Sistem kunci publik sangat terukur, memungkinkan komunikasi yang aman antara pihak-pihak tanpa interaksi sebelumnya.
- Keserbagunaan: Kunci publik mendukung berbagai fungsi, seperti enkripsi, autentikasi, dan memverifikasi tanda tangan digital.
Keterbatasan Kunci Publik
- Performa yang lebih lambat: Algoritme enkripsi asimetris lebih intensif secara komputasi dibandingkan dengan metode simetris, sehingga kurang cocok untuk kumpulan data yang besar.
- Peningkatan Kompleksitas: Mengelola infrastruktur kunci publik (PKI) bisa menjadi tantangan dan membutuhkan sumber daya yang signifikan.
Kekuatan Kunci Pribadi
- Efisiensi: Kunci privat, yang digunakan dalam enkripsi simetris, lebih cepat dan membutuhkan daya komputasi yang lebih sedikit, sehingga ideal untuk mengenkripsi data dalam jumlah besar.
- Kesederhanaan: Karena hanya satu kunci yang dibutuhkan, sistem ini tidak terlalu rumit dibandingkan enkripsi asimetris.
Keterbatasan Kunci Pribadi
- Tantangan Distribusi Kunci: Membagikan kunci pribadi dengan aman di antara para pihak adalah hal yang sulit dan menimbulkan risiko keamanan yang signifikan.
- Masalah Skalabilitas: Mengelola beberapa kunci privat menjadi tidak praktis ketika jumlah pengguna meningkat.
Untuk mengatasi tantangan ini, sistem enkripsi hibrida sering kali menggabungkan kekuatan keduanya. Sebagai contoh, enkripsi asimetris dapat digunakan untuk menukar kunci sesi dengan aman, yang kemudian digunakan untuk enkripsi simetris yang lebih cepat. Pendekatan ini menyeimbangkan efisiensi kunci pribadi dengan manfaat distribusi yang aman dari kunci publik.
Dengan memahami kekuatan dan kelemahan kunci-kunci ini, perusahaan dan individu dapat memilih metode enkripsi yang sesuai dengan kebutuhan mereka, sehingga memastikan keamanan dan kinerja yang optimal.
Buka Keyakinan Digital dengan SSL Dragon
Kunci publik dan pribadi adalah fondasi komunikasi yang aman, melindungi data sensitif dan memastikan kepercayaan di dunia digital. Namun, memahami konsep-konsep ini hanyalah permulaan. Untuk benar-benar mengamankan keberadaan online Anda, Anda memerlukan alat yang tepat.
Di SSL Dragonkami menawarkan sertifikat SSL terkemuka di industri yang dirancang untuk melindungi situs web Anda, melindungi data pengguna, dan membangun kepercayaan dengan audiens Anda. Baik Anda adalah bisnis kecil atau perusahaan global, solusi kami membuat keamanan menjadi sederhana dan efektif. Jelajahi rangkaian sertifikat SSL/TLS kami hari ini dan ambil langkah pertama menuju kepercayaan digital yang tak tertandingi. Amankan situs Anda dengan SSL Dragon sekarang!
Hemat 10% untuk Sertifikat SSL saat memesan hari ini!
Penerbitan cepat, enkripsi kuat, kepercayaan peramban 99,99%, dukungan khusus, dan jaminan uang kembali 25 hari. Kode kupon: SAVE10